Transaction 71790f950e5458ed52bc6fe26e49af28633e26cb45892bdf1d41e5df646a5f12

1 Input
1 Outputs
  • 71790f950e5458ed52bc6fe26e49af28633e26cb45892bdf1d41e5df646a5f12:0
  • value  681951
    address  33tkXfi9mDXjA4YdrfK7APAQMyPqznuCap